Analysis
In 2024, share of all students in lower secondary education enrolled in in Venezuela stood at 89.0%. That is the lowest value across all 22 years on record.
That represents a change of down 11.0% on the previous year and down 11.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of all students in lower secondary education enrolled in in Venezuela peaked at 100.0% in 1999 and was at its lowest, 89.0%, in 2024.
Venezuela ranks 187th of 197 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
